The recent passing of Roger Speed, father of the late Gary Speed, has sparked an outpouring of tributes from the football community, particularly from Leeds United and its supporters. This sad news has brought back memories of Gary Speed's tragic death in 2011 and his remarkable career, which included winning the First Division title with Leeds United.

A Legacy of Love and Support
The tributes from Leeds United and the Football Association of Wales highlight Roger Speed's role as a passionate supporter of Welsh football and his son's career. The FAW's statement emphasizes how deeply Gary Speed is held in the heart of Welsh football, and Roger's support and passion will forever be remembered.

A Tour of Memories
The Leeds United Supporters Trust's tribute is especially moving. Their tour of the murals featuring Gary Speed a few years ago, with Roger and his family, is a beautiful example of how football can create lasting memories and connections.
